TOLEDO, Ohio – Former Rocket great
Laura Nicholson will represent Team Ireland in the 2025 World Athletics Championships in Tokyo, Japan on Sept. 13-21. Nicholson is the first female Rocket to compete in the World Athletics Championships.
Nicholson will see action in the women's 1500m event for Team Ireland. She qualified for the World Championship after becoming the Irish National Champion in the 1500m with a final time of 4:13.32.
Competition for Nicholson will begin on Sept. 13 at 6:50 a.m. ET with the 1500m heats. The semifinals will be held on Sept. 14 at 8:05 a.m. ET with the finals on Sept. 16 at 9:05 a.m.
The Cork, Ireland native holds five Toledo track & field records, including the 17
th-fastest 1500m time in NCAA history with a mark of 4:07.17. She was an NCAA East First Round Qualifier, the 2025 MAC Most Outstanding Performer at the Indoor Track and Field Championships and named First-Team All-MAC five times throughout cross country and track & field.
The only other Rocket to compete in the World Athletics Championship was Paul Sehzue. Sehzue represented Liberia in the 1999 World Athletics Championships in Seville, Spain and competed in the 100m hurdles and 4x100m relays.
